Charlotte, NC
Mecklenburg County
Charlotte HOA architectural review boards (ARB/ARC) operate under NC Gen Stat ยง47F-3-107.1 of the Planned Community Act. Associations must have written standards, provide reasonable review timelines (typically 30-60 days), and allow appeals. Decisions denying approval must state reasons in writing. Homeowners have enforcement and challenge rights through the courts.

Mecklenburg County
Matthews HOAs enforce architectural review committees (ARC) under recorded CCRs. Approval required before exterior changes, paint colors, additions, fences, and landscaping. Written decisions typically required within 30-60 days per bylaws.
